Abstract

Influence of chlorofluorocarbon refrigerants on climate warming has become in recent years a serious concern of both scientists and state officials in different countries of the world.
The main directions of solving this problem at present are measures aimed at reduction of refrigerant leakage from refrigeration systems, reduction of its volume in the system, as well as gradual transfer of refrigeration equipment to operation with such natural refrigerants as ammonia, hydrocarbons, carbon dioxide. This review briefly highlights different aspects of using these refrigerants in supermarket refrigeration systems.
